SUBJECT: GERMAN ASSURANCES REGARDING POTENTIAL SALE OF
GERMAN PRINTING PRESS TO DPRK

REF: STATE 61051

(S) Global Affairs Counselor and Global Affairs Officer delivered ref demarche to Michael Findeisen, the German Finance Ministry's Director of the Money Laundering and Terrorist Finance Division, May 11. Findeisen stated there is no/no likelihood of Drent Goebel beginning production at this point of the offset/intaglio press North Korea has sought. He noted North Korea has not paid even the initial deposit that would be necessary before the firm would start production. Findeisen agreed with the importance of continued vigilance against the possibility that the DPRK might try to obtain the printing press through duplicitous methods. He noted a legal agreement exists between the German Government and Drent Goebel that the company will inform the German Ministries of Economy and Foreign Affairs if North Korea approaches it again to resume the order for the printing press. Findeisen said the German Government has the legal authority, using a provision of the Foreign Trade and Payments Act, to prevent Drent Goebel from exporting the printing press to North Korea. Responding to the Global Affairs Counselor's query, Findeisen clarified that the German Government has the authority to block the export through an administrative order. The Foreign Trade and Payments Act is flexible enough, he said, to allow the government to restrict legal transactions and acts in foreign trade to "guarantee the vital security interests of the Federal Republic of Germany," Findeisen added. ¶2. (S) In answer to Global Affairs Counselor's question about North Korea possibly using a middleman or false end user on a new sales contract, Findeisen said that if Drent Goebel begins manufacturing an offset/intaglio press, even for an end user outside the DPRK, the German Government has the authority to investigate the order. ¶3. (S) Findeisen asked whether the USG has considered the possibility that the DPRK Government might use its assets recently unfrozen in Banco Delta of Macao to pay for the printing press, if not from Drent Goebel then from another manufacturer. Findeisen added, however, that even if North Korea were to try that route, Drent Goebel is required to inform the German Government, which would then issue the administrative order necessary to prevent the sale.
